Output 8e02072b41f10e727cbc8399af10a4c401b889015016d82e7b51ab1074986095:3

value
81005720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63bdef72b42c53e6d3b36e3ae7f5461b95fb0d68 OP_EQUAL
address
MGzYfMrqKxEhyyhm8tgnRtnoaYXhr3YZXJ
transaction
8e02072b41f10e727cbc8399af10a4c401b889015016d82e7b51ab1074986095
spent
true